0

我在处理网站并尝试对其进行更改时遇到问题。

首先,假设我的网站是 www.example.com。我下载了 Putty,进入会话,使用主机名(或 IP 地址)为 www.example.com,连接类型为 SSH。我使用从网站管理员那里获得的用户名和密码登录了我的帐户,并拥有 myName@example:~$。

然后,我去了github.com。这个地方是网站的 git 存储库所在的地方,我的管理员告诉我去那里。我将存储库克隆到我的 unix 帐户,目前有一个网站 url www.example.com/~myName/

在 putty 中,我有一些网站的 css 代码,并想更改网站的某些部分。所以为了做到这一点,我下载了 WinSCP 并用它将网站的 css 文件传输到我的笔记本电脑,更改 css 代码,然后将新代码传输到 putty 帐户。

当我做less filename.css时,我可以看到我的腻子帐户上的更改,但是当我尝试登录我的帐户网站 www.example/~myName/ 时,没有出现更改。为了解决这个问题,我应该做一些与 github.com 打交道的事情,并为我正在处理的存储库创建一个新分支或其他东西,还是我需要做其他事情?感谢所有的帮助。

4

1 回答 1

1

您应该执行以下操作,而不是使用 WinSCP 进行更改:

  1. 在您的笔记本电脑上安装 Web 服务器(检查 Windows 上的 WAMP)
  2. 在您的笔记本电脑上克隆您的 Github 存储库(C:/wamp/www如果您在 Windows 上)
  3. 现在,您可以在笔记本电脑(和less它们)上进行更改并查看它们http://localhost/

当您对修改感到满意时,您可以执行以下操作:

  1. 从您的笔记本电脑推送您的存储库以将更改发送到 Github
  2. 登录您的服务器
  3. 从服务器上的 Github 拉取更改
  4. 现在您可以使用已应用的更改访问您的网站www.example/~myName/

这是使用配置管理系统的正确方法。

于 2013-07-07T00:12:39.913 回答